vsound

Vsound est une application Linux / Unix qui vous permet d'enregistrer numériquement la sortie d'un autre programme tel que RealPlayer.
Télécharger maintenant

vsound Classement & Résumé

Publicité

  • Rating:
  • Licence:
  • GPL
  • Prix:
  • FREE
  • Nom de l'éditeur:
  • Peter Clay
  • Site Internet de l'éditeur:
  • http://www.vsound.org/

vsound Mots clés


vsound La description

Vsound est une application Linux / Unix qui vous permet d'enregistrer numériquement la sortie d'un autre programme tel que RealPlayer. Vsound est une application Linux / Unix qui vous permet d'enregistrer numériquement la sortie d'un autre programme tel que RealPlayer. La sortie enregistrée peut être enregistrée dans un fichier WAV ou peut être envoyée dans un autre programme tel qu'un encodeur MP3.Le programme Vsound utilise une technique très intéressante si une technique inhabituelle pour effectuer ses travaux. Linux et d'autres systèmes de type Unix permettent de remplacer les fonctions dans une bibliothèque partagée sans avoir à remplacer toute la bibliothèque. Ceci est fait en écrivant une nouvelle bibliothèque partagée qui contient les définitions des fonctions que vous souhaitez remplacer. En outre, par l'utilisation de la fonction DLSYM (), il est toujours possible d'appeler la fonction d'origine en utilisant un pointeur de fonction.Dans le cas de Vsound, les fonctions qui doivent être remplacées sont; ouvert (), ioctl (), écrire () et fermer (). En reproduisant ces fonctions, il est possible de détecter toutes les tentatives d'ouverture du périphérique / dev / dsp. À partir de là, tous les appels IOCTL () sur cet appareil sont enregistrés dans un fichier qui peut ensuite être utilisé pour déterminer le format de données du fichier joué. De plus, la fonction d'écriture standard () est également remplacée afin que toutes les données audio écrites sur le périphérique audio soient également écrites dans un fichier temporaire. De même, la fonction Fermer () est remplacée, nous savons donc quand fermer le fichier contenant les données audio capturées. Les fonctions que nous souhaitons remplacer sont rassemblées dans une bibliothèque partagée appelée libvsound.so. L'autre partie du système vsound est un script shell appelé vsound. Ce script shell utilise la variable LD_PRELOAD pour indiquer au système de précharger libvsound.so, puis exécutez le programme cible avec toutes ses arguments de ligne de commande. Lorsque le programme cible se termine, le script de shell vsound utilise SOX pour convertir le fichier de format au format A en un fichier WAV nommé vsound.wav dans le répertoire actuel. Qu'est-ce qui est nouveau dans cette version: · vsound.c · roulé dans le patch Autostop par Richard Taylor tue Le joueur après un nombre défini de secondes d'inactivité (défini comme l'heure que le périphérique / dev / dsp est fermé) · vsound.in · --Autostop (-a) Traitement de l'option Autostop (-a) de dessus Patch ajouté fixe non fonctionnel non fonctionnel - Échantillon (-R) Option


vsound Logiciels associés

XTMIX

XTMIX est un programme de mixage KDE Cays, prend en charge la gestion de la session et est simple à utiliser. ...

147

Télécharger

Modeler

MP3Cattle est une interface graphique basée sur Java pour une base de données contenant des informations MP3. ...

142

Télécharger

L'eau tue

Bemused est un système qui vous permet de contrôler votre collection de musique à partir de votre téléphone, à l'aide de Bluetooth. ...

151

Télécharger

ac3jack

Ac3Jack est un outil de création d'un flux multicanaux AC-3 (Dolby Digital) à partir de ses ports d'entrée Jack. ...

201

Télécharger